roentgen b75cab
roentgen b75cab
roentgen b75cab
<title></title>
roentgen b75cab
Changes in TIFF v3.4beta007
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ab
roentgen b75cab
<font face="Arial, Helvetica, Sans"></font>
roentgen b75cab
roentgen b75cab
<basefont size="4"></basefont>
roentgen b75cab
<font size="+3">T</font>IFF <font size="+2">C</font>HANGE <font size="+2">I</font>NFORMATION
roentgen b75cab
<basefont size="3"></basefont>
roentgen b75cab
roentgen b75cab
    roentgen b75cab

    roentgen b75cab
    Current Version: v3.4beta007
    roentgen b75cab
    Previous Version: v3.4beta004
    roentgen b75cab
    Master FTP Site: ftp.sgi.com (192.48.153.1), directory graphics/tiff
    roentgen b75cab

    roentgen b75cab
    roentgen b75cab
    roentgen b75cab

    roentgen b75cab
    This document describes the changes made to the software between the
    roentgen b75cab
    previous and current versions (see above).
    roentgen b75cab
    If you don't find something listed here, then it was not done in this
    roentgen b75cab
    timeframe, or it was not considered important enough to be mentioned.
    roentgen b75cab
    The following information is located here:
    roentgen b75cab
      roentgen b75cab
    • Changes in the software configuration
    • roentgen b75cab
    • Changes in libtiff
    • roentgen b75cab
    • Changes in the portability support
    • roentgen b75cab
    • Changes in the tools
    • roentgen b75cab
      roentgen b75cab
      roentgen b75cab


      roentgen b75cab
      roentgen b75cab
      <font size="+3">C</font>HANGES IN THE SOFTWARE CONFIGURATION:
      roentgen b75cab
      roentgen b75cab
        roentgen b75cab
      • bit order was corrected for Pentium systems
      • roentgen b75cab
      • a new define, <tt>HOST_BIGENDIAN</tt>, was added for code that
      • roentgen b75cab
           wants to statically use information about native cpu byte order
        roentgen b75cab
        roentgen b75cab
        roentgen b75cab


        roentgen b75cab
        roentgen b75cab
        <font size="+3">C</font>HANGES IN LIBTIFF:
        roentgen b75cab
        roentgen b75cab
          roentgen b75cab
        • the G3/G4 decoder was replaced by a new one that is faster and
        • roentgen b75cab
             has smaller state tables
          roentgen b75cab
        • Niles Ritter's client tag extension hooks were added
        • roentgen b75cab
        • a new routine <tt>TIFFCurrentDirOffset</tt> was added for
        • roentgen b75cab
             applications that want to find out the file offset of a TIFF directory
          roentgen b75cab
        • the calculation of the number of strips in an image was corected
        • roentgen b75cab
             for images with certain esoteric configurations
          roentgen b75cab
        • a potential memory leak (very unlikely) was plugged
        • roentgen b75cab
        • the <tt>TIFFReadRGBAImage</tt> support was completely rewritten
        • roentgen b75cab
             and new, more flexible support was added for reading images into
          roentgen b75cab
             a fixed-format raster
          roentgen b75cab
        • YCbCr to RGB conversion done in the <tt>TIFFReadRGBAImage</tt> support
        • roentgen b75cab
             was optimized
          roentgen b75cab
        • a bug in JPEG support calculation of strip size was corrected
        • roentgen b75cab
        • the LZW decoder was changed to initialize the code table to zero
        • roentgen b75cab
             to lessen potential problems that arise when invalid data is decoded
          roentgen b75cab
        • tiffcomp.h is now aware of OS/2
        • roentgen b75cab
        • some function prototypes in tiffio.h and tiffiop.h
        • roentgen b75cab
             that contained parameter
          roentgen b75cab
             names have been changed to avoid complaints from certain compilers
          roentgen b75cab
          roentgen b75cab
          roentgen b75cab


          roentgen b75cab
          roentgen b75cab
          <font size="+3">C</font>HANGES IN THE PORTABILITY SUPPORT:
          roentgen b75cab
          roentgen b75cab
            roentgen b75cab
          • Makefile.in has been corrected to use the parameters
          • roentgen b75cab
               chosen by the configure script
            roentgen b75cab
            roentgen b75cab
            roentgen b75cab


            roentgen b75cab
            roentgen b75cab
            <font size="+3">C</font>HANGES IN THE TOOLS:
            roentgen b75cab
            roentgen b75cab
              roentgen b75cab
            • <tt>fax2ps</tt> has been rewritten and moved over from the user
            • roentgen b75cab
                 contributed software
              roentgen b75cab
            • an uninitialized variable in <tt>pal2rgb</tt> has been fixed
            • roentgen b75cab
            • <tt>ras2tiff</tt> now converts 24-bit RGB raster data so that
            • roentgen b75cab
                 samples are written in the proper order
              roentgen b75cab
            • <tt>tiff2ps</tt> has been updated to include fixes
            • roentgen b75cab
                  and enhancements from Alberto Accomazzi
              roentgen b75cab
            • <tt>tiffcp</tt> now has a <tt>-o</tt> option to select a directory
            • roentgen b75cab
                  by file offset
              roentgen b75cab
            • <tt>tiffinfo</tt> is now capable of displaying the raw undecoded
            • roentgen b75cab
                  image data in a file
              roentgen b75cab
            • <tt>tiffgt</tt> has been rewritten to use the new <tt>TIFFRGBAImage</tt>
            • roentgen b75cab
                 support and to handle multiple files
              roentgen b75cab
              roentgen b75cab
              roentgen b75cab
               TIFF home page.
              roentgen b75cab
              roentgen b75cab

              roentgen b75cab
              roentgen b75cab
              <address></address>
              roentgen b75cab
              Sam Leffler / sam@engr.sgi.com
              roentgen b75cab
              Last updated $Date: 1999/08/09 20:21:21 $.
              roentgen b75cab
              roentgen b75cab
              roentgen b75cab
              roentgen b75cab